Iron Testing is a diagnostic test that measures the levels of iron in the blood. Iron is an essential mineral required for the production of hemoglobin, a protein in red blood cells that carries oxygen throughout the body. Testing for iron levels helps assess iron deficiency or iron overload, both of which can have significant health implications.
Residents of Guerneville, California, with symptoms such as fatigue, weakness, pale skin, dizziness, and shortness of breath may benefit from Iron Testing. Individuals with certain risk factors, such as chronic blood loss, poor dietary iron intake, pregnancy, or certain medical conditions, may also require testing.

The interpretation of Iron Testing results involves analyzing the levels of iron, transferrin, TIBC, and ferritin. Abnormalities in these values may indicate iron deficiency anemia or iron overload conditions.

After Iron Testing, healthcare providers discuss the results with individuals and recommend appropriate interventions based on the test findings. Treatment options may include iron supplementation, dietary changes, and addressing the underlying cause of iron imbalance.
